I downloaded the News module, installed it and it works okay. The only thing is, I'd like my home page to look like the news page when you click on the news link in the menu. I've tried all the news blocks(top news, big story, recent news), played with their configs, but I can't get them to look the same as the news page. I want authors, posting date, a topic link followed by a title link, and the read more bar (yes, I do have text in both the scoop and extended boxes) with size and comments count on my home page. Any suggestions?

You can set your homepage to the news module
In the XOOPS System Prefs, there an option in General Settings called "Module for your start page"
Set that to the news module.
